![](https://img-blog.csdnimg.cn/20201014180756724.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
ARM体系结构学习
文章平均质量分 76
ARM体系结构学习整理记录
浪矢杂谈
ISP芯片领域嵌入式工程师 | 芯片BSP/SDK
种一棵树最好的时间是十年前,其次是现在...
展开
-
ARM架构学习(二)——流水线
本期主题:ARM流水线往期地址:ARMv7架构学习ARM流水线1.流水线概念2.指令的分解步骤1.流水线概念硬件资源总是有限的,有一个明显的方法能改善硬件资源的利用率,这就是pipeline(流水线)技术,其实就是在当前指令结束之前就开始执行下一条指令。ARM中的流水线是这么做的:当一条指令刚执行完步骤1,准备转向步骤2时,下一条条指令开始执行步骤1。2.指令的分解步骤一条指令在被处理器运行时,实际上会被拆解成很多步骤,典型的计算机系统步骤如下:首先,处理器需要从存储器中取指原创 2021-11-07 20:38:37 · 1924 阅读 · 0 评论 -
ARMv7架构学习
本文参考至ARM的官方手册ARM® Architecture Reference ManualARMv7-A and ARMv7-R edition文章目录1.ARM的基本设定2.ARM处理器的工作模式1.有哪些模式2.设置这些模式的原因3.异常处理4.常用汇编指令1.ARM的基本设定ARMv7 采用的是32位架构Byte: 8 bitsHalfword: 16bits(2 byte)Word: 32 bits(4 byte)ARM core提供:ARM指令集(32 bits)T原创 2020-11-08 21:21:10 · 9213 阅读 · 0 评论